CAS 108321-19-3
:L-proline P-nitroanilide*trifluoroacetic acid
Description:
L-proline P-nitroanilide trifluoroacetic acid is a chemical compound that serves as a derivative of L-proline, an amino acid, and is often utilized in biochemical applications, particularly in peptide synthesis and as a substrate in enzymatic assays. The presence of the P-nitroanilide moiety enhances its utility in colorimetric assays, as it can produce a measurable color change upon reaction with specific enzymes. Trifluoroacetic acid (TFA) is included in the structure, which is known for its strong acidity and ability to facilitate the solubilization of various compounds, making it useful in peptide synthesis and purification processes. The compound is typically characterized by its stability under standard laboratory conditions, although it may be sensitive to moisture and should be handled with care. Its applications extend to research in biochemistry and molecular biology, where it can be used to study enzyme kinetics and protein interactions. Overall, L-proline P-nitroanilide trifluoroacetic acid is a valuable tool in the field of chemical biology.
Formula:C11H13N3O3·C2HF3O2
